There are two categories to enter:

• Poetry, up to 30 lines, on the theme 'To a Friend'. This year's poetry contest celebrates the 200th anniversary of the publication of John Keats' first poetry anthology.

• Essays up to 3,000 words on any aspect of the lives and works of Keats, Shelley and their circle.

The winners will share a prize fund of £4,000.

Entry is free. All entries must be original and unpublished.

The closing date to enter the Keats-Shelley Prize 2016-2017 is 15 January.
